  • More about Renewable Energy Crash Course: A Concise Introduction


This book provides a concise and reader-friendly introduction to renewable energy technologies, using simplified classroom-tested methods developed by the authors for engineering students. It covers basic principles, types, energy storage, grid integration, and economics in simple language, making it a valuable resource for students, engineers, technicians, analysts, investors, and professionals who need to acquire a solid understanding of renewable energy technology quickly.
